BLUEFIELD, Va. (Jan. 26, 2019) – The Truett McConnell University women's basketball team faced Appalachian Athletic Conference foe Bluefield College for the second time this season on Saturday afternoon. The Lady Bears fell to the Rams on the road (59-45) to fall to 4-17, 3-15 AAC on the year while Bluefield improved to 11-11, 10-8 AAC.
SLOW START | FOURTH QUARTER WIN
The Rams dominated the first 20 minutes of regulation holding the Lady Bears to a total of 14 points and held a 14-point lead heading into halftime (14-28). TMU picked up the pace in the third quarter working to only be outscored by three points. However, it was the fourth quarter that the Lady Bears won. Trailing by as big as 20 points, TMU managed to outscore the Rams by three (17-14) to cut the deficit down to 13.
LEADERS
Freshman Re'Tavia Floyd led with 21 points while sophomore Sierra Kendall and freshman Quan Holton added four points apiece. Holton led with five rebounds and freshman Sydney Rumble was credited two assists and tallied three steals.
